Program Overview

The Medicine program at the Lithuanian University of Health Sciences (LSMU) is a comprehensive six-year course designed to equip students with a solid foundation in medical science and practical clinical skills. Conducted in English, the program emphasizes hands-on training through a blend of lectures, practical sessions, and clinical rotations in various healthcare settings. Students cover a broad range of subjects, including anatomy, physiology, and pharmacology, with a strong focus on patient-centered care. The curriculum prepares graduates for successful careers in the healthcare field, adhering to European Union standards for medical education.

Experiential Learning (Research, Projects, Internships etc.)

The Medicine program at the Lithuanian University of Health Sciences (LSMU) incorporates several experiential learning opportunities to enhance students' education and practical skills:

Research Opportunities

  • Undergraduate Research Projects: Students can participate in faculty-led research projects that focus on various medical disciplines, promoting critical thinking and innovation.
  • Research Skills Development: Training includes methodologies for effective research, critical analysis, and presentation of findings.

Clinical Internships

  • Clinical Rotations: Throughout the six-year program, students engage in clinical placements in hospitals and clinics, gaining real-world experience in patient care.
  • Interprofessional Collaboration: Internships often involve working alongside other healthcare professionals, helping students learn collaborative approaches to patient management.

Extracurricular Projects

  • Health Campaigns: Students may participate in community health initiatives, promoting awareness on various health issues and providing basic health services to underserved populations.
  • Workshops and Seminars: Regular workshops cover advanced medical topics, offering further practical knowledge and skills development applicable to medical practice.

These experiential learning components aim to prepare graduates for future challenges in healthcare and encourage a hands-on approach to medical education.
